您的根组件中包含哪些内容

时间:2017-06-15 22:14:36

标签: angular

我正在使用角度CLI,我已经生成了一个新项目。你的app.component.ts通常会发生什么?

我还没有找到它的用途,因为其他一切都在它自己的模块/组件中

2 个答案:

答案 0 :(得分:0)

app.component.ts通常充当应用程序的根组件。放置路由器插座的位置,页眉,页脚和路由器插座是根据您的路由保存视图的插座。

<app-header></app-header>
<router-outlet></router-outlet>
<footer></footer>

了解更多信息:https://angular.io/guide/quickstart

答案 1 :(得分:0)

app.component.html的典型示例是布局模板和<router-outlet></router-outlet>元素。 app-root应该被认为是你应用程序的主要入口点,所以基本上你把你想看的内容放在整个应用程序中

另一方面,app.component.ts内部应该是在应用执行期间仅执行 的代码。配置服务,在素材图标服务中注册自定义图标,配置全局变量等。基本上配置内容应执行一次的代码。